We already know that the Tesla Model S, especially in its most powerful, 100D iteration, can get ludicrously fast

But it doesn't stop there. A modified version of the fastest Model S, created for the Electric GT Championship, is even faster, reaching 0-100kmh (0-62mph) in an insane 2.1 seconds. 

The number, which according to MotorAuthority has been officially confirmed by Electric GT, means the car speeds up from 0-60mph in about 2 seconds. No production cars come close to being that fast; for comparison, the fastest "regular" Model S speeds up to 60mph in 2.4 seconds. Read more...
